transport addresses now displays in dashboard

This commit is contained in:
Kevin 2020-06-21 17:55:32 -05:00
parent 6c75c525d2
commit 817f0263db
3 changed files with 45 additions and 16 deletions

View File

@ -30,6 +30,7 @@
<script defer src="/private/js/motd.js"></script>
<script defer src="/shared/navbar.js"></script>
<script defer src="/private/js/windows.js"></script>
<script defer src="/shared/main/loadTransport.js"></script>
<script>alert("Content security policy appears to not be working. Your browser security is weak!")</script>
</head>
@ -250,22 +251,21 @@
</div>
</div>
<details>
<summary>Transport addresses</summary>
<div class="field has-addons torTransportField">
<p class="control">
<a class="button is-static">
<i class="fas fa-adjust"></i>
</a>
</p>
<p class="control is-expanded">
<input id="myTor" class="input myTor" type="text" readonly>
</p>
<p class="control">
<a id="myTorCopy" class="button is-primary"><i class="fas fa-copy"></i></a>
</p>
</div>
</details>
<h4>Transports</h4>
<div class="field has-addons torTransportField">
<p class="control">
<a class="button is-static">
<i class="fas fa-adjust"></i>
</a>
</p>
<p class="control is-expanded">
<input class="input myTor" type="text" readonly>
</p>
<p class="control">
<a class="button is-primary myTorCopy"><i class="fas fa-copy"></i></a>
</p>
</div>
<i class="fas fa-link"></i>
Outgoing Connections:

View File

@ -56,4 +56,8 @@
z-index: 2;
position: fixed;
}
.torTransportField {
margin-top: 2em;
}

View File

@ -0,0 +1,25 @@
fetch('/gettoraddress', {
headers: {
"token": webpass
}})
.then((resp) => resp.text())
.then(function(resp) {
let torBoxes = document.getElementsByClassName('myTor')
Array.from(torBoxes).forEach(element => {
element.value = resp
})
})
Array.from(document.getElementsByClassName('myTorCopy')).forEach(element => {
element.onclick = function(){
var copyText = document.getElementsByClassName('myTor')[0]
copyText.select()
document.execCommand("copy")
if (typeof PNotify != 'undefined'){
PNotify.success({
text: "Copied to clipboard"
})
}
}
})